etc

(M1 mac) R KoNLP설치 방법

J-Mook 2022. 1. 7. 10:08
반응형

https://www.java.com
위 링크에서 자바설치

Step 0. 기본 한글 인코딩 설정

defaults write org.R-project.R force.LANG ko_KR.UTF-8

Step 1. 의존성 패키지 설치

install.packages(c("cli","hash", "tau", "Sejong", "RSQLite", "devtools", "bit", "rex", "lazyeval", "htmlwidgets", "crosstalk", "promises", "later", "sessioninfo", "xopen", "bit64", "blob", "DBI", "memoise", "plogr", "covr", "DT", "rcmdcheck", "rversions"), type = "binary")

Step 2. github 버전 설치 후 KoNLP 설치

install.packages("remotes")

KoNLP 설치

remotes::install_github('haven-jeon/KoNLP', upgrade = "never", INSTALL_opts=c("--no-multiarch"))

[오류 해결 방법] -> https://jmook.tistory.com/14

 

(M1 mac) R KoNLP설치 오류

로컬 터미널에서 sudo R CMD javareconf JAVA_HOME 부분 경로 복사 R console에 아래 코드 입력 Sys.setenv(“JAVA_HOME”=‘복사한거 붙혀넣기’) dyn.load(‘복사한거 붙혀넣기/lib.server/libjvm.dylib’) * 에..

jmook.tistory.com

라이브러리 적용

library(rJava)
library(KoNLP)

Step 3. 테스트하기

txt <- '나는 사과와 바나나가 좋아요'
extractNoun(txt)
반응형